发表评论取消回复
相关阅读
相关 从多线程角度看Java中锁的使用和问题
在Java多线程编程中,锁(Synchronized)是一种重要的同步机制,用于保护共享资源不受并发访问的干扰。 1. 锁的使用: - synchronized关键字:
相关 从多线程角度看Java死锁:实例展示
在多线程环境下,Java中的死锁是指两个或更多的线程相互等待资源,而这些资源又被其他线程占用,从而导致所有线程都无法继续执行的现象。 以下是一个简单的死锁实例: ```ja
相关 从JVM角度看,Java多线程开发需要避开的误区
在Java JVM视角下,多线程开发确实存在一些常见的误解。以下是需要避免的一些误区: 1. **共享内存就是线程共享**:虽然多线程可以共享全局变量或对象,但JVM内部实现
相关 从并发角度看,Java多线程常见问题实例
在并发编程中,Java多线程常遇到一些问题。以下是一些实例: 1. **死锁**: - 描述:当两个或更多的线程因争夺资源而造成的一种互相等待的现象称为死锁。 -
相关 【转载】从JVM角度看Java多态
原文链接:[https://www.cnblogs.com/qingergege/p/6853547.html][https_www.cnblogs.com_qingergeg
相关 从 JVM 角度看字符串拼接
一 字符串拼接操作 常量与常量的拼接结果在常量池,原理是编译期优化 常量池中不会存在相同内容的常量 只要其中有一个是变量,结果就在堆中,变量拼接的原理是
相关 从JVM角度来看对象
在Java中要创建一个对象最简单方法就是new,当然大部分情况下我们还是通过spring来管理对象。但对于JVM来说一个对象的创建、存亡可没那么简单了。 对象的创建 虚
相关 从App的角度看进程和线程
![640_wx_fmt_png_tp_webp_wxfrom_5_wx_lazy_1][] 在现在人人都有一部手机或电脑的年代,我们几乎天天都在使用各种app,如微信,QQ
相关 从App的角度看进程和线程
原创发自我的公众号:我是攻城师 \[url\]https://mp.weixin.qq.com/s?\_\_biz=MzAxMzE4MDI0NQ==&mid=2650
相关 Java多线程 - 从JVM角度理解多线程
在JVM中,多个线程共享进程的堆和方法区资源,但每个线程有自己的程序计数器、虚拟机栈和本地方法栈 什么是堆 Java虚拟机所管理的内存中最大的一块,java堆是所有线程
还没有评论,来说两句吧...